[QUOTE="Justice C. Bigler, post: 31888, member: 74"] Re: The way real pros do it This doesn't fly in my house. If you want full access to the system processors, then you can bring your own rig, or require the promoter to rent in a full rig. My responsibility is to the House and our equipment. Because we are a City owned entity, it's almost impossible for us to replace broken gear in a timely manner, and we have no mechanism in place for an at fault act or production company to just swap out a working speaker or amp for the one they blew up. Now, that being said, if you seem like you know what you are doing and you're not a dick, I'll probably let you look at the XTA or Galileo settings under my supervision. But, I'm not going to let you reconfigure the entire system just for your one night 90 minute long show. [/QUOTE]
